About the job
What is my role?
This position offers you the opportunity to apply and further develop your expertise in simulations. In addition to complex structural mechanics and fluid dynamics issues, you will work on innovative preliminary development projects and be responsible for physical simulation scopes in the field of structural mechanics and fluid dynamics. This particularly includes the following activities:
Support of product development/maintenance with validated simulation methods
Consulting production plants and sales companies on structural mechanics and fluid dynamics issues
Leading innovative preliminary development projects
Automation of simulation activities
Collaboration with external partners as well as supervision of interns and master’s students
What do I need to be successful?
You have a university degree (preferably a doctorate) in physics, mechanical engineering, aerospace engineering or a comparable field. In addition, you are characterised by the following qualities and skills:
Extensive professional experience in virtual development (Ansys Mechanical, Ansys Fluent, Ansys CFX)
Proficient in Python, Linux, HPC
In-depth experience in experimental methodology and data analysis
Team player with enthusiasm for interdisciplinary collaboration
Strong analytical and conceptual skills
